LUSCIOUS LEMON SQUARES
Provided by Anne Thornton, Host of Dessert First
Categories dessert
Time 3h25m
Yield 20 to 24 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- For the crust: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Grease a 9 by 13-inch baking sheet (otherwise known as a quarter sheet pan) with some cooking spray.
- In a stand mixer with the paddle attachment (or you can use a food processor), cream your butter with the sugar and almond extract until light and fluffy. Whisk the flour and salt in a small bowl, making sure there are no lumps. Turn the mixer speed to low, add the flour into your butter and mix until just incorporated. (Make sure not to over-mix.) Turn the dough onto the baking sheet, flour your hands and press it out evenly on the bottom and up the sides. Pop in the fridge for an hour (or overnight) to chill.
- Pop the crust in the oven and bake until a light golden brown, about 20 minutes. Cool completely on a wire rack.
- For the filling: While the crust is cooling, make your filling. Crack your eggs into a large bowl and add the sugar, lemon zest, lemon juice and flour. Whisk until combined. Pour into the crust and spread evenly. Put back in the oven and bake until the filling is completely set, about 30 minutes. Let cool to room temperature before serving.
- Dust with confectioners' sugar and then cut into 20 to 24 squares to serve. Garnish with raspberries, if desired.

THE BEST CHEWY C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ES RECIPE BY TASTY
There are a few secrets to the best classic, chewy chocolate chip cookies. Number one: Don't use chips; instead, opt for a mix of milk or semisweet and dark chocolate chunks. The second is to let the dough rest overnight or longer for a more complex, toffee-like flavor. Lastly, use an ice cream scooper to get even-sized cookies every time. And that's it! With these little tweaks, the result is a cookie that's textured on the outside, and soft and gooey on the inside. Absolutely perfect!
Provided by Alvin Zhou
Categories Desserts
Time 1h5m
Yield 12 cookies
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- In a large bowl, whisk together the sugars, salt, and butter until a paste forms with no lumps.
- Whisk in the egg and vanilla, beating until light ribbons fall off the whisk and remain for a short while before falling back into the mixture.
- Sift in the flour and baking soda, then fold the mixture with a spatula (Be careful not to overmix, which would cause the gluten in the flour to toughen resulting in cakier cookies).
- Fold in the chocolate chunks, then chill the dough for at least 30 minutes. For a more intense toffee-like flavor and deeper color, chill the dough overnight. The longer the dough rests, the more complex its flavor will be.
- Preheat oven to 350°F (180°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Scoop the dough with an ice-cream scoop onto a parchment paper-lined baking sheet, leaving at least 4 inches (10 cm) of space between cookies and 2 inches (5 cm) of space from the edges of the pan so that the cookies can spread evenly.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the edges have started to barely brown.
- Cool completely before serving.

LUSCIOUS LUMPS COOKIES - ROLL WITH THE DOUGH
From rollwiththedough.com
Category DessertEstimated Reading Time 4 mins
- Cream butter; add powdered sugar and beat until creamy. Add cornstarch and vanilla. Sift the flour and add to creamed butter mixture. Stir in chocolate chips and walnuts.
- Use 2 small serving spoons (we call them teaspoons) to drop the cookies onto the cookie sheet about 1-1/2" apart. Bake at 350 degrees for 15 minutes. Let cool for 5 minutes on cookie sheet, then transfer to cooling rack. When completely cool, sprinkle with powdered sugar. Enjoy!
